NORM stands for Naturally Occurring Radioactive Material. NORM refers to radioactive materials that are found naturally in the environment. These materials can be found in rocks, soil, water, and air. NORM can also be found in industrial products and byproducts.
NORM testing is the process of measuring the amount of radioactivity in a material. This testing is important because exposure to NORM can be harmful to human health.
Why is NORM Testing Important?
NORM testing is important for several reasons:
* To protect human health from exposure to NORM.
* To ensure that materials containing NORM are handled and disposed of safely.
* To comply with environmental regulations.
What are the Types of NORM Testing?
There are several types of NORM testing, including:
* Gamma spectrometry: This is the most common type of NORM testing. Gamma spectrometry measures the amount of gamma radiation emitted by a material.
* Alpha spectrometry: This type of testing measures the amount of alpha radiation emitted by a material.
* Radionuclide analysis: This type of testing identifies the specific radionuclides that are present in a material.
* Bioassay: This type of testing measures the amount of radioactivity in a person's body.
What are the Applications of NORM Testing?
NORM testing is used in a variety of applications, including:
* Mining and processing of NORM-containing materials: This includes the mining and processing of uranium, phosphate, and zircon.
* Oil and gas production: NORM can be found in oil and gas wells, pipelines, and storage tanks.
* Water treatment: NORM can be found in water that is sourced from groundwater or from rivers and lakes that flow through areas with NORM-containing rocks and soil.
* Manufacturing: NORM can be found in industrial products such as fertilizers, ceramics, and glass.
* Decommissioning of nuclear facilities: NORM can be found in materials that were contaminated with radioactive materials during the operation of a nuclear facility.
What are the Regulations for NORM Testing?
The regulations for NORM testing vary depending on the country. In the United States, the Environmental Protection Agency (EPA) is responsible for regulating NORM. The EPA has set standards for the maximum amount of NORM that can be present in materials that are released to the environment.
